BMW R 1300 GS Adventure 2024

BMW R 1300 GS Adventure 2024

The new R 1300 GS Adventure was eagerly awaited - how will the Bavarians differentiate it from the normal 13 Series GS in terms of design? Well, the powerful, angular appearance is already a success, the new big Adventure looks rustic, but doesn't look too stolid and you can see at first glance with the many practical details that BMW is all about making globetrotters happy. On the drive side, the GS Adventure benefits from the even more powerful boxer engine, which accelerates the heavy Adventure forwards effortlessly and agilely. The handling is unexpectedly light and the ergonomics are excellent. Of course, the BMW R 1300 GS Adventure is expensive, nobody expected a bargain. However, it is already equipped with an extensive range of electronic features in the basic version, and with the ASA automated quickshifter, adaptive ride height control, adaptive cruise control and much, much more, it is of course even more expensive. But beware: anyone who tries it will probably want it on their R 1300 GS Adventure!

Agile boxer transmission

amazingly easy handling

great ergonomics for long distances

30 litre fuel capacity

lean angle-dependent Advanced Rider Assistance Systems

various modes

heated grips as standard

cruise control as standard

automated quickshifter as an accessory

adaptive cruise control as an accessory

High weight - difficult to balance from the stand

high price

lengthy surcharge list - but nobody should be surprised...

Brixton Cromwell 1200 2024

Brixton Cromwell 1200 2024

The Brixton Cromwell 1200 surprises with an exciting combination of classic design and pubertal riding performance. With this bike, you can really step on the gas and look stylish at the same time. Although it quickly reaches its limit in the bends, it is also pleasant to ride for longer distances. Due to the rough riding performance, a pinch of sensitivity is required with the throttle and clutch

Stylish design

Sport mode with guaranteed fun

Powerful sound

USB TYPE A charging socket in the cockpit

Comfortable seat

Great driving stability

Lean angle quickly exhausted

Rough engine

No quickshifter

Display not intuitive and difficult to read
